/*
* This function parse IPv4 and IPv6 packets looking for TCP and UDP
* headers.
*
* Upon return the pointer at which the "ppth" argument points, is set
* to the location of the TCP header. NULL is used if no TCP header is
* present.
*
* The return value indicates the number of bytes from the beginning
* of the packet until the first byte after the TCP or UDP header. If
* this function returns zero, the parsing failed.
*/
int
mlx5e_get_full_header_size(const struct mbuf *mb, const struct tcphdr **ppth)
{
const struct ether_vlan_header *eh;
const struct tcphdr *th;
const struct ip *ip;
int ip_hlen, tcp_hlen;
const struct ip6_hdr *ip6;
uint16_t eth_type;
int eth_hdr_len;
eh = mtod(mb, const struct ether_vlan_header *);
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< ETHER_HDR_LEN))
goto failure;
if (eh->evl_encap_proto == htons(ETHERTYPE_VLAN)) {
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< ETHER_HDR_LEN + 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N))
goto failure;
eth_type = ntohs(eh->evl_proto);
eth_hdr_len = ETHER_HDR_LEN + 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N;
} else {
eth_type = ntohs(eh->evl_encap_proto);
eth_hdr_len = ETHER_HDR_LEN;
}
switch (eth_type) {
case ETHERTYPE_IP:
ip = (const struct ip *)(mb->m_data + eth_hdr_len);
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< eth_hdr_len + sizeof(*ip)))
goto failure;
switch (ip->ip_p) {
case IPPROTO_TCP:
ip_hlen = ip->ip_hl << 2;
eth_hdr_len += ip_hlen;
goto tcp_packet;
case IPPROTO_UDP:
ip_hlen = ip->ip_hl << 2;
eth_hdr_len += ip_hlen + sizeof(struct udphdr);
th = NULL;
goto udp_packet;
default:
goto failure;
}
break;
case ETHERTYPE_IPV6:
ip6 = (const struct ip6_hdr *)(mb->m_data + eth_hdr_len);
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< eth_hdr_len + sizeof(*ip6)))
goto failure;
switch (ip6->ip6_nxt) {
case IPPROTO_TCP:
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*ip6);
goto tcp_packet;
case IPPROTO_UDP:
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*ip6) + sizeof(struct udphdr);
th = NULL;
goto udp_packet;
default:
goto failure;
}
break;
default:
goto failure;
}
tcp_packet:
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< eth_hdr_len + sizeof(*th))) {
const struct mbuf *m_th = mb->m_next;
if (unlikely(mb->m_len != eth_hdr_len ||
m_th == NULL || m_th->m_len < sizeof(*th)))
goto failure;
th = (const struct tcphdr *)(m_th->m_data);
} else {
th = (const struct tcphdr *)(mb->m_data + eth_hdr_len);
}
tcp_hlen = th->th_off << 2;
eth_hdr_len += tcp_hlen;
udp_packet:
/*
* m_copydata() will be used on the remaining header which
* does not need to reside within the first m_len bytes of
* data:
*/
if (unlikely(mb->m_pkthdr.len < eth_hdr_len))
goto failure;
if (ppth != NULL)
*ppth = th;
return (eth_hdr_len);
failure:
if (ppth != NULL)
*ppth = NULL;
return (0);
}

/*
* This function parse IPv4 and IPv6 packets looking for UDP, VXLAN
* and TCP headers.
*
* The return value indicates the number of bytes from the beginning
* of the packet until the first byte after the TCP header. If this
* function returns zero, the parsing failed.
*/
static int
mlx5e_get_vxlan_header_size(const struct mbuf *mb, struct mlx5e_tx_wqe *wqe,
uint8_t cs_mask, uint8_t opcode)
{
const struct ether_vlan_header *eh;
struct ip *ip4;
struct ip6_hdr *ip6;
struct tcphdr *th;
struct udphdr *udp;
bool has_outer_vlan_tag;
uint16_t eth_type;
uint8_t ip_type;
int pkt_hdr_len;
int eth_hdr_len;
int tcp_hlen;
int ip_hlen;
int offset;
pkt_hdr_len = mb->m_pkthdr.len;
has_outer_vlan_tag = (mb->m_flags & M_VLANTAG) != 0;
offset = 0;
eh = mtod(mb, const struct ether_vlan_header *);
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< ETHER_HDR_LEN))
return (0);
if (eh->evl_encap_proto == htons(ETHERTYPE_VLAN)) {
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< ETHER_HDR_LEN + 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N))
return (0);
eth_type = eh->evl_proto;
eth_hdr_len = ETHER_HDR_LEN + 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N;
} else {
eth_type = eh->evl_encap_proto;
eth_hdr_len = ETHER_HDR_LEN;
}
switch (eth_type) {
case htons(ETHERTYPE_IP):
ip4 =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*ip4));
if (unlikely(ip4 == NULL))
return (0);
ip_type = ip4->ip_p;
if (unlikely(ip_type != IPPROTO_UDP))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l3_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.cs_flags = MLX5_ETH_WQE_L3_CSUM | M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_CSUM;
ip_hlen = ip4->ip_hl << 2;
eth_hdr_len += ip_hlen;
udp =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*udp));
if (unlikely(udp ==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l4_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_SWP_OUTER_L4_TYPE;
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*udp);
break;
case htons(ETHERTYPE_IPV6):
ip6 =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*ip6));
if (unlikely(ip6 == NULL))
return (0);
ip_type = ip6->ip6_nxt;
if (unlikely(ip_type != IPPROTO_UDP))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l3_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.cs_flags = M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_CSUM;
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*ip6);
udp =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*udp));
if (unlikely(udp ==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l4_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_SWP_OUTER_L4_TYPE |
MLX5_ETH_WQE_SWP_OUTER_L3_TYPE;
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*udp);
break;
default:
return (0);
}
/*
* If the hardware is not computing inner IP checksum, then
* skip inlining the inner outer UDP and VXLAN header:
*/
if (unlikely((cs_mask & MLX5_ETH_WQE_L3_INNER_CSUM) == 0))
goto done;
if (unlikely(m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
8) == NULL))
return (0);
eth_hdr_len += 8;
/* Check for ethernet header again. */
eh =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len, ETHER_HDR_LEN);
if (unlikely(eh == NULL))
return (0);
if (eh->evl_encap_proto == htons(ETHERTYPE_VLAN)) {
if (unlikely(mb->m_len < eth_hdr_len - offset + ETHER_HDR_LEN +
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N))
return (0);
eth_type = eh->evl_proto;
eth_hdr_len += ETHER_HDR_LEN + 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N;
} else {
eth_type = eh->evl_encap_proto;
eth_hdr_len += ETHER_HDR_LEN;
}
/* Check for IP header again. */
switch (eth_type) {
case htons(ETHERTYPE_IP):
ip4 =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*ip4));
if (unlikely(ip4 ==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l3_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.cs_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_L3_INNER_CSUM;
ip_type = ip4->ip_p;
ip_hlen = ip4->ip_hl << 2;
eth_hdr_len += ip_hlen;
break;
case htons(ETHERTYPE_IPV6):
ip6 =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*ip6));
if (unlikely(ip6 ==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l3_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_SWP_INNER_L3_TYPE;
ip_type = ip6->ip6_nxt;
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*ip6);
break;
default:
return (0);
}
/*
* If the hardware is not computing inner UDP/TCP checksum,
* then skip inlining the inner UDP/TCP header:
*/
if (unlikely((cs_mask & M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_INNER_CSUM) == 0))
goto done;
switch (ip_type) {
case IPPROTO_UDP:
udp =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*udp));
if (unlikely(udp ==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l4_offset = (eth_hdr_len / 2);
wqe->eth.cs_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_INNER_CSUM;
wqe->eth.swp_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_SWP_INNER_L4_TYPE;
eth_hdr_len += sizeof(*udp);
break;
case IPPROTO_TCP:
th = mlx5e_parse_mbuf_chain(&mb, &offset, eth_hdr_len,
sizeof(*th));
if (unlikely(th == NULL))
return (0);
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l4_offset = eth_hdr_len / 2;
wqe->eth.cs_flags |= M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_INNER_CSUM;
tcp_hlen = th->th_off << 2;
eth_hdr_len += tcp_hlen;
break;
default:
return (0);
}
done:
if (unlikely(pkt_hdr_len < eth_hdr_len))
return (0);
/* Account for software inserted VLAN tag, if any. */
if (unlikely(has_outer_vlan_tag)) {
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l3_offset += 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_outer_l4_offset += 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l3_offset += 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N / 2;
wqe->eth.swp_inner_l4_offset += ETHER_VLAN_ENCAP_LEN / 2;
}
/*
* When inner checksums are set, outer L4 checksum flag must
* be disabled.
*/
if (wqe->eth.cs_flags & (MLX5_ETH_WQE_L3_INNER_CSUM |
M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_INNER_CSUM))
wqe->eth.cs_flags &= ~MLX5_ETH_WQE_L4_CSUM;
return (eth_hdr_len);
}
